DescriptionViews depict factories and mills in various locations throughout Connecticut, including Baltic, Norwich, Rockville, and Winsted. Several photographs depict Ponemah Mills in the Taftville section of Norwich; other mills are identified as being at Norwich Falls and in the Greenvill section of Norwich. Several photographs were taken by Hartford photographers and are probably of mills in the Hartford area. One mill is identified as a cotton mill. One photograph shows a mill dam.
Part of the John S. Craig Collection.
